Essential Cleaning Checklist for Exit Cleaning

When preparing for exit cleaning, having a detailed cleaning checklist is crucial for ensuring that you meet your tenant obligations. This checklist not only helps you stay organized but also increases your chances of receiving your bond back guarantee. Begin by focusing on the kitchen, where many tenants overlook hidden areas. Clean inside the oven, wipe down cabinets, and sanitize countertops to impress real estate agents during property inspections.

Next, address the bathrooms. Scrub tiles, remove soap scum from shower screens, and ensure that all fixtures are gleaming. Don’t forget to check under sinks for any forgotten items or potential mold buildup. These details are often scrutinized by professional cleaners, so make sure your efforts align with their high standards.

Lastly, give attention to the living areas and bedrooms. Dust surfaces, vacuum carpets, and wipe down light switches and door handles. A thorough exit cleaning will not only leave the property in excellent condition but also demonstrate your commitment to maintaining rental properties responsibly.
